How to use "at bay" in a sentence?

  • With care, and skill, and cunning art, She parried Time's malicious dart, And kept the years at bay, Till passion entered in her heart and aged her in a day!
    -Ella Wheeler Wilcox-
  • People assume that somehow fame and wealth will keep mortality at bay.
    -Moby-
  • I am caught like a beast at bay. Somewhere are people, freedom, light, But all I hear is the baying of the pack, There is no way out for me.
    -Boris Pasternak-
  • Reading - the best state yet to keep absolute loneliness at bay.
    -William Styron-
  • My mother insured that a life of petty facts and dutiful farming was kept at bay by her passionate intensity, which nurtured the essential dreaminess of his nature
    -Josephine Hart-
  • During the day, memories could be held at bay, but at night, dreams became the devil's own accomplices.
    -Sharon Kay Penman-
  • It kept him alive, he was certain; even more, it kept his darkest of his demons at bay.
    -Tina St. John-
  • In the days that follow, it's movement, not stillness, that helps to keep the grief at bay.
    -Veronica Roth-
